Northwest Texas Healthcare System Behavioral Health Hospital names Rene Havel as Chief Executive Officer

AMARILLO, Texas (KAMR/KCIT) — Northwest Texas Healthcare System has appointed Rene Havel, EdD, LPC-S, as Chief Executive Officer of its Behavioral Health hospital.

According to NWTHS officials, Havel has been a leader at NWTHS since 2016. She has driven clinical advancements while advancing through leadership roles, including Counselor, Clinical Supervisor, Director of Clinical Services and Case Management, and most recently, Interim CEO of Behavioral Health. During her tenure as Interim CEO, Havel successfully expanded access to services.

Prior to joining NWTHS, officials said Havel built extensive expertise in counseling, case management, and clinical supervision. She also proudly served in the United States Marine Corps, where she forged the leadership, discipline, and resilience that continue to guide her dedication to patients, staff, and the Amarillo community. Havel is a Licensed Professional Counselor Supervisor and holds a Doctor of Education, reflecting the highest standard of professional competence in healthcare administration.

Havel shared, “I am deeply honored to step into this role permanently. Having served this facility for a decade, I look forward to working alongside our dedicated team to expand critical health care and resources throughout the Texas Panhandle.”…
